ATTENTION ALL LOBBYISTS

Chapter 2, Article VII, Division 3 of the City Code of Miami Beach, entitled "Lobbyists," requires the registration of all lobbyists with the Office of the City Clerk prior to engaging in any lobbying activity with the City Commission, any City Board or Committee, or any personnel as defined in the subject Code sections. Copies of the City Code sections on lobbyists laws are available in the Office of the City Clerk. Questions regarding the provisions of the Ordinance should be directed to the Office of the City Attorney.

R7AA RESOLUTION OF THE MAYOR AND CITY CO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F MIAMI BEACH, FLORIDA, ESTABLISHING, PURSUANT TO THE RECOMMENDATION OF THE POLICE/CITIZENS RELATIONS COMMITTEE, AN “AD HOC SPRING BREAK TASK FORCE ADVISORY COMMITTEE,” FOR A PERIOD OF ONE YEAR (SUBJECT TO EARLIER OR LATER SUNSET BY THE CITY COMMISSION) TO ADVISE THE ADMINISTRATION AND CITY COMMISSION ON THE UPCOMING MARCH 2024 SPRING BREAK PERIOD, AND TO PROVIDE A FORUM TO ADDRESS QUALITY OF LIFE AND PUBLIC SAFETY ISSUES AFFECTING OUR RESIDENTS AND BUSINESS OWNERS DURING EVERY SPRING BREAK PERIOD; AND PRESCRIBING THE PURPOSE, COMPOSITION, POWERS, AND DUTIES OF THE COMMITTEE.

R7BA RESOLUTION OF THE MAYOR AND CITY CO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F MIAMI BEACH, FLORIDA, SUSPENDING THE DEVELOPMENT OF ANY CITY-ACTIVATED SPECIAL EVENTS DURING THE SECOND AND THIRD WEEKS OF MARCH 2024 SPRING BREAK PERIOD; IN LIEU THEREOF, ENDORSING, IN CONCEPT, THE USE OF THAT PORTION $3.2 MILLION THE CITY EXPENDED IN FY 2022 FOR SECOND AND THIRD WEEKS OF MARCH 2023 EVENT ACTIVATIONS FOR ADDITIONAL PUBLIC SAFETY PURPOSES DURING 2024 MARCH SPRING BREAK; AND FURTHER, DIRECTING THE CITY ADMINISTRATION TO FOCUS ON IDENTIFYING A QUALITY, TRANSFORMATIVE, FAMILY-FRIENDLY EVENT PROGRAM, WITHIN A SECURED AND CONTROLLED PERIMETER, TO BE POTENTIALLY IMPLEMENTED AS PART OF THE 2025 MARCH SPRING BREAK PERIOD, AS PREVIOUSLY DIRECTED BY THE CITY COMMISSION.
